【技术实现步骤摘要】
一种用于网络安全产品的测试系统、测试方法及存储介质
本专利技术涉及产品检测,具体涉及一种用于网络安全产品的测试系统及测试方法。
技术介绍
网络安全是指网络系统的硬件、软件及其系统中的数据受到保护,不因偶然或者恶意的原因而遭受到破坏、更改、泄露,系统连续可靠正常地运行,网络服务不中断。随着互联网技术的发展,各行各业对网络的依赖越来越强,网络安全也引起越来越多的重视,因此催生越来越多的网络安全产品。网络安全产品的性能测试以及产品测试过程中的保密性对生产者而言都至关重要。现有技术上中,对于网络安全产品的测试,一部分采用人工测试方式,一方面耗费大量的人力成本,另一方面人工测试效率相对较低;网络安全产品的测试往往是在产品出厂上市之前处于保密状态,而现有的网络安全测试系统在进行产品测试时,往往通过单次密码验证即可进行测试,难以保证产品测试的保密性和安全性。
技术实现思路
专利技术目的:本申请的目的在于提供一种用于网络安全产品的测试系统,解决现有测试系统测试效率低、安全性不高的缺陷;本申请还相应提供一种 ...
【技术保护点】
1.一种用于网络安全产品的测试系统,其特征在于,包括客户端和服务器;/n所述客户端包括:/n准入模块,其被配置为对用户进行身份验证和权限验证;/n存储模块,其被配置为存储用于验证的身份信息和权限信息;/n指令生成模块,其被配置为根据通过验证的用户的测试请求向所述服务器发送测试指令;/n显示模块,其被配置为用于显示测试步骤指引及测试结果信息;/n所述服务器包括:/n报警模块,其被配置为根据报警指令进行警示;/n指令判定模块,其被配置为根据所述测试指令判定对应的测试需求是否在权限范围内,若否,则向所述报警模块发送越权报警指令;/n访问密码验证模块,其被配置为响应于在权限范围内的 ...
【技术特征摘要】
1.一种用于网络安全产品的测试系统,其特征在于,包括客户端和服务器;
所述客户端包括:
准入模块,其被配置为对用户进行身份验证和权限验证;
存储模块,其被配置为存储用于验证的身份信息和权限信息;
指令生成模块,其被配置为根据通过验证的用户的测试请求向所述服务器发送测试指令;
显示模块,其被配置为用于显示测试步骤指引及测试结果信息;
所述服务器包括:
报警模块,其被配置为根据报警指令进行警示;
指令判定模块,其被配置为根据所述测试指令判定对应的测试需求是否在权限范围内,若否,则向所述报警模块发送越权报警指令;
访问密码验证模块,其被配置为响应于在权限范围内的测试需求,向所述客户端发送访问密码输入请求,并根据来源于客户端的访问密码进行访问密码验证,若访问密码未通过验证,则向所述报警模块发送访问密码报警指令;
产品数据库模块,其被配置为存储待测产品对应的标准测试数据,并针对访问密码通过验证的用户,根据用户权限开放对应标准测试数据的访问权限;
测试密钥验证模块,其被配置为响应于所述测试需求,向所述客户端发送产品密钥输入请求,并根据来源于所述客户端的密钥,验证用户的测试权限,若用户未通过密钥验证,则所述报警模块发送密钥报警指令;
所述测试模块,其被配置为根据通过产品密钥验证的测试请求,基于所述待测产品对应标准测试数据,对所述待测产品进行测试。
2.根据权利要求1所述的系统,其特征在于,所述准入模块包括身份识别单元,其被配置为通过磁卡录入用户信息,识别用户是否具有系统使用权限。
3.根据权利要求2所述的系统,其特征在于,所述准入模块还包括身份验证单元,其被配置为通过登录密码和/或生物特征识别技术验证用户身份是否与所述磁卡录入的用户信息一致。
4.根据权利要求3所述的系统,其特征在于,所述身份验证单元的生物特征识别技术可采用指纹识别、虹膜识别、面...
【专利技术属性】
技术研发人员:曾纪钧,龙震岳,温柏坚,沈伍强,张小陆,沈桂泉,张金波,梁哲恒,
申请(专利权)人:广东电网有限责任公司,
类型:发明
国别省市:广东;44
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。